Overview
David Dickens is a Hematologist and an Oncologist practicing medicine in Iowa City, Iowa. He has been practicing medicine for over 26 years.
Dr. Dickens is highly rated in 13 conditions, according to our data. His clinical expertise encompasses Acute Lymphoblastic Leukemia (ALL), Leukemia, Hepatoblastoma, Histiocytosis, and Bone Marrow Aspiration.
He is actively involved in clinical research, co-authoring 42 peer reviewed articles and participating in 59 clinical trials.
